Definition
serial_set_inter_byte_timeout(ser, timeout=None)
Features
This function sets the timeout between the bytes (inter-byte) when reading and writing to the port.
Parameters
|
Parameter Name |
Data Type |
Default Value |
Description |
|---|---|---|---|
|
ser |
serial.Serial |
- |
Serial instance |
|
timeout |
float |
None |
Timeout between bytes during reading or writing
|
Return
|
Value |
Description |
|---|---|
|
0 |
Success |
Exception
|
Exception |
Description |
|---|---|
|
DR_Error (DR_ERROR_TYPE) |
Parameter data type error occurred |
Example
Python
ser = serial_open(port="COM", baudrate=115200, bytesize=DR_EIGHTBITS,
parity=DR_PARITY_NONE, stopbits=DR_STOPBITS_ONE)
res = serial_set_inter_byte_timeout(ser, 0.1)
serial_close(ser)
